uap:FileTypeAssociation (Windows 10)
Deklariert einen App-Erweiterbarkeitspunkt vom Typ windows.fileTypeAssociation. Eine Dateitypzuordnung gibt an, dass die App registriert ist, um Dateien der angegebenen Typen zu verarbeiten.
Elementhierarchie
<uap:FileTypeAssociation>
Syntax
<uap:FileTypeAssociation
Name = 'A string with a value between 1 and 100 characters in length.'
DesiredView = 'An optional string that can have one of the following values: "default", "useLess", "useHalf", "useMore", or "useMinimum".'
desktop2:UseUrl = 'An optional boolean value.'
desktop2:AllowSilentDefaultTakeOver = 'An optional boolean value.'
desktop5:ThumbnailTypeOverlay = 'A string with a value between 1 and 256 characters in length that ends with ".jpg", ".png", or ".jpeg" that cannot contain these characters: <, >, :, ", |, ?, or *. In this string, the / and \ characters cannot be the first or last characters. Also, the string can contain / or \ but not both.' >
<!-- Child elements -->
uap:DisplayName?
& uap:Logo?
& uap:InfoTip?
& uap:EditFlags?
& uap:SupportedFileTypes?
& uap2:SupportedVerbs?
& uap4:KindMap?
& rescap3:MigrationProgIds?
& desktop2:ThumbnailHandler?
& desktop2:OleClass?
& desktop2:DesktopPreviewHandler?
& desktop2:DesktopPropertyHandler?
& desktop3:PropertyLists?
& desktop7:Logo?
& desktop7:ProgId?
& desktop10:IconHandler?
</uap:FileTypeAssociation>
Schlüssel
?
optionaler (null oder eins) &
interleave Connector (kann in beliebiger Reihenfolge auftreten)
Attribute und Elemente
Attribute
attribute | BESCHREIBUNG | Datentyp | Erforderlich | Standardwert |
---|---|---|---|---|
Name | Der Name der Dateitypzuordnung. Mit diesem Namen kannst du Dateitypen organisieren und gruppieren. Der Name darf nur Kleinbuchstaben und keine Leerzeichen umfassen. | Eine Zeichenfolge mit einem Wert zwischen 1 und 100 Zeichen. | Yes | |
DesiredView | Der gewünschte Bildschirmraum, der beim Starten der App verwendet werden soll. Diese Einstellung für den Ansichtsmodus ist nur ein angeforderter Wert. Die von Ihnen angegebene bevorzugte Größe wird von Windows nicht berücksichtigt. Daher sollten Sie keinen Code schreiben, der darauf angewiesen ist, niemals eine Größe zu erhalten, die kleiner als die bevorzugte Mindestgröße oder größer als die bevorzugte maximale Größe ist. | Eine optionale Zeichenfolge, die einen der folgenden Werte aufweisen kann: default, useLess, useHalf, useMore oder useMinimum. | No | |
desktop2:UseUrl | Gibt bei Festlegung auf true an, dass die Anwendung eine URL anstelle eines Dateinamens in der Befehlszeile akzeptieren kann. Anwendungen, die Dokumente direkt aus dem Internet öffnen können, z. B. Webbrowser und Media Player, sollten diesen Wert verwenden. Wenn ShellExecuteEx eine Anwendung gestartet wird und dieser Wert auf false festgelegt ist, lädt das Standardverhalten ShellExecuteEx das Dokument in eine lokale Datei herunter und ruft den Handler für die lokale Kopie auf. |
Ein optionaler boolescher Wert. | No | |
desktop2:AllowSilentDefaultTakeOver | Wenn true festgelegt ist, wird die App in der Liste "Öffnen mit" angezeigt, aber sie ist nicht die Standard-App für den Dateityp. | Ein optionaler boolescher Wert. | No | |
desktop5:ThumbnailTypeOverlay | Eine Bildressource für eine Miniaturansichtsüberlagerung. | Eine Zeichenfolge mit einem Wert zwischen 1 und 256 Zeichen, die mit , oder endet und die folgende Zeichen nicht enthalten kann: < , > , : , " , | ? , oder * ..jpeg .png .jpg In dieser Zeichenfolge dürfen die / Zeichen und \ nicht das erste oder letzte Zeichen sein. Außerdem kann die Zeichenfolge oder \ enthalten/ , aber nicht beides. |
No |
Untergeordnete Elemente
Untergeordnetes Element | Beschreibung |
---|---|
uap:DisplayName | Ein Anzeigename, der Benutzern angezeigt werden kann. |
uap:EditFlags | Gibt den Typ der Informationen an, die dem Benutzer beim Öffnen einer Datei angezeigt werden, die dem Erweiterbarkeitspunkt zugeordnet ist. |
uap:InfoTip | Definiert eine Zeichenfolge, die dem Benutzer zusätzliche Informationen zum Dateityp bereitstellt. |
uap:Logo | Ein Pfad zu einer Datei, die ein Bild enthält. |
uap:SupportedFileTypes (Typ: CT_FTASupportedFileTypes) | Definiert die dateitypen, die der App zugeordnet sind. Sie sind pro Paket eindeutig und beachten die Groß-/Kleinschreibung. |
uap2:SupportedVerbs | Enthält Verben für ein Dateikontextmenü. |
uap4:KindMap | Gibt an, was Kind ist und wie es verwendet wird. |
rescap3:MigrationProgIds | Enthält ProgID-Werte (Programmatic Identifier ), die die Anwendung, Komponente und Version jeder Desktopanwendung beschreiben, von der Sie Dateizuordnungen erben möchten. |
desktop2:ThumbnailHandler | Aktiviert einen ThumbnailProvider für eine Dateitypzuordnung. |
desktop2:OleClass | Ermöglicht OLE das Abrufen der OLE-Klasse, die für eine bestimmte Dateierweiterung registriert ist. |
desktop2:DesktopPreviewHandler | Aktiviert die Deklaration eines Vorschauhandlers für eine Dateitypzuordnung. |
desktop2:DesktopPropertyHandler | Aktiviert die Deklaration eines Eigenschaftenhandlers für eine Dateitypzuordnung. |
desktop3:PropertyLists | Enthält eine Liste der Eigenschaften, die auf der Registerkarte Eigenschaften einer Datei angezeigt werden sollen. |
desktop7:Logo | Ein Pfad zu einer Datei, die ein Bild enthält. Fügt Unterstützung für ICO-Dateierweiterungen hinzu. |
desktop7:ProgId | Ein programmgesteuerter Bezeichner (ProgID), der einer CLSID zugeordnet werden kann. |
desktop10:IconHandler | Aktiviert einen IconHandler für eine Dateitypzuordnung. |
Übergeordnete Elemente
Übergeordnetes Element | Beschreibung |
---|---|
uap:Extension | Deklariert einen Erweiterbarkeitspunkt für die App. |
Anforderungen
Element | Wert |
---|---|
Namespace | http://schemas.microsoft.com/appx/manifest/uap/windows10 |
Minimum OS Version | Windows 10 Version 1511 (Build 10586) |
Feedback
https://aka.ms/ContentUserFeedback.
Bald verfügbar: Im Laufe des Jahres 2024 werden wir GitHub-Issues stufenweise als Feedbackmechanismus für Inhalte abbauen und durch ein neues Feedbacksystem ersetzen. Weitere Informationen finden Sie unterFeedback senden und anzeigen für